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_001164397.3(TRIM64B):āc.487A>Cā(p.Thr163Pro)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000657 in 152,250 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ā ).

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Jul 30, 2023 | The c.487A>C (p.T163P) alteration is located in exon 2 (coding exon 2) of the TRIM64B gene. This alteration results from a A to C substitution at nucleotide position 487, causing the threonine (T) at amino acid position 163 to be replaced by a proline (P).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
